Click here to read the articleMissing Attachment Continued from part 1: Now that I’ve covered a bit about power ratings of the amplifier, let’s move on the the loudspeaker. Among other things, speakers are rated in Watts. This is again the subject of the most misunderstanding and abuse by marketing. Here I will attempt to break down what this all really means. Click here to read the articleMissing Attachment In-car video game systems are immensely popular these days. Initially sales were driven by needs of children but with many adults discovering their inner-child who never grew up, the market has opened up substantially. In-car video or entertainment systems can be broadly classified into three types namely, factory fitted or retrofitted, semi-portable systems, and portable laptop systems.
